Das Notes Forum

Domino 9 und frühere Versionen => ND8: Entwicklung => Thema gestartet von: booltrue am 10.11.17 - 11:26:38

Titel: Export von selektierten Dokumenten mit Mehrfachwerten
Beitrag von: booltrue am 10.11.17 - 11:26:38
Hallo,

ich exportiere Dokumente aus einem View.
Die Dokumente können Mehrfachwerte enthalten, die aber getrennt angezeigt werden, je als weitere Zeile.

Wenn ich alle Dokumente aus dem View exportiere, funktioniert das einwandfrei, alle Dokumente mit Mehrfachwerten werden
exportiert.

Selektiere ich ein Dokument, das Mehrfachwerte enthält, dann werden alle zugehörigen Zeilen automatisch
mitselektiert, der Export enthält dann aber nur eine Zeile mit einem Mehrfachwert.
Ist ja auch soweit richtig, da in db.unprocesseddocuments count=1 ist

Wie kann ich aber alle selektierten Mehrfachwerte exportieren, so wie sie im View selektiert erscheinen und wie es ja auch funktioniert, wenn ich den
ganzen View exportiere ?

Grüße
Titel: Re: Export von selektierten Dokumenten mit Mehrfachwerten
Beitrag von: JoeeoJ am 11.11.17 - 14:55:40
Hallo,

ein bisschen mehr Info über deine Export-Methode wäre schon sinnvoll.
Also kann ich nur vermuten was du machst: Notes DocumentCollection ?
Ich denke du solltest es mit dem ViewNavigator und der ViewEntry Klassen versuchen, das ist näher an der View Darstellung dran.

Gruss, Joe
Titel: Re: Export von selektierten Dokumenten mit Mehrfachwerten
Beitrag von: booltrue am 13.11.17 - 10:56:17
Ja, NotesDocumentCollection.

db.unprocesseddocuments war hier nicht richtig.

Ich benutzte NotesUIView.Documents, um nur die selektierten Dokumente zu erhalten.
Leider funktioniert das mit Mehrfachwerten nicht. Ich bekomme nur einen davon in der
NotesDocumentCollection angezeigt und Columnvalues ist leer.
Wenn ich über alle Dokumente laufe mit NotesView, bekomme ich alle Mehrfachwerte und
Columnvalues ist nicht leer.
Da ich aber nur die selektierten Dokumente benötige, muss ich NotesUIView.Documents verwenden,
nur klappt das dann mit den Mehrfachwerten nicht.

Habe mir NotesViewNavigator angeschaut, der bringt mich leider nicht weiter.

Was ich benötige ist Zugriff von NotesView auf die in NotesUIView selektierten Dokumente.
Gibt es keine Möglichkeit über NotesView zu sehen, welche Dokumente im NotesUIView selektiert wurden ?

Der Zugriff auf Mehrfachwerte über NotesView funktioniert einwandrei, ich bekomme alle Dokumente.
Der Zugriff über NotesUIView funktioniert leider nicht bei selektierten Mehrfachwerten.



Titel: Re: Export von selektierten Dokumenten mit Mehrfachwerten
Beitrag von: it898ur am 16.11.17 - 09:53:35
Normalerweise hilft hier der Einsatz der NotesViewEntryCollection (Nutzung siehe Hilfe von Notes)

Viele Grüße

André